Skyservice™ Introduces Global Wi-Fi Solutions for Bombardier Challenger Aircraft

Skyservice™ Unveils Global Wi-Fi for Challenger Aircraft



Skyservice Business Aviation, recognized as a leading entity in North America’s business aviation landscape, has taken a significant leap forward in enhancing aircraft connectivity. The company recently introduced a Supplemental Type Certificate (STC) for the innovative Gogo Galileo HDX system, specifically tailored for Bombardier Challenger models CL604, CL605, and CL650. With the official approval from Transport Canada, Skyservice has established itself as the first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ul (MRO) service in North America to successfully implement this next-generation global broadband connectivity solution.

Benjamin Murray, the President and CEO of Skyservice, articulated the growing need for connectivity in modern business aviation, stating, "Connectivity is no longer a luxury, it's a necessity for today's business aviation clients." He expressed pride in delivering high-performance, future-ready connectivity solutions that keep Challenger owners and operators globally connected.

The introduction of the Gogo Galileo system marks a pivotal moment in the Canadian business aviation sector. Skyservice has already completed two successful installations of this system in a Challenger 605 aircraft and is actively advancing certification with regulatory bodies such as the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), European Union Aviation Safety Agency (EASA), and the National Civil Aviation Agency of Brazil (ANAC). This extensive project aims to encompass approximately 570 Challenger aircraft, thereby reinforcing the global reach of Skyservice’s initiatives.

For existing Challenger 604, 605, and 650 aircraft equipped with the Gogo AVANCE system, transitioning to the Gogo Galileo system is straightforward and efficient. Installation can be completed in as little as seven business days, minimizing downtime and ensuring a smooth upgrade process.

About Skyservice™ MRO


Skyservice operates as a comprehensive global provider for MRO services catering to business and commercial aircraft. Committed to upholding quality, service excellence, and punctual project delivery, Skyservice has secured approvals from multiple aviation regulatory authorities, including TCCA, FAA, EASA, BDCA, HK-CAD, 2-REG, Aruba, and CAAS.

Their extensive service offerings include scheduled maintenance, avionics updates, AOG services, aircraft parts supplies, aircraft teardown, and recycling, non-destructive testing (NDT), Pre-Purchase Inspections (PPI), and an array of STCs on leading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) aircraft brands.
